Start by Defining Your Travel Style
Before booking any tours or activities, think about what you actually want from your trip. Some travelers enjoy history and architecture, while others prefer food tours, outdoor adventures, cultural experiences, or entertainment. Identifying your interests early makes it much easier to choose activities that genuinely appeal to you.
Consider who you are traveling with as well. A family vacation may require child-friendly attractions and flexible schedules, while a romantic getaway might focus on scenic experiences, fine dining, and private tours. Solo travelers may prefer guided group activities that provide opportunities to meet other people. Understanding your travel style helps prevent your itinerary from becoming a long list of activities that you do not have enough time or energy to enjoy.

Build a Flexible Itinerary
A good itinerary should provide structure without controlling every minute of your vacation. Start by identifying the experiences you consider essential and arrange them around your travel dates. After that, leave some free time for spontaneous discoveries, relaxing at your hotel, or simply enjoying the destination at your own pace.
Avoid scheduling too many major activities on the same day. Visiting several attractions in different parts of a city can quickly become exhausting when transportation and queues are taken into account. Instead, group experiences by location whenever possible. This approach saves travel time and gives you more opportunities to explore the surrounding area.

Choose the Right Type of Tour
Tours come in many different formats, and choosing the right one can make a major difference to your experience. Walking tours are ideal for exploring historic neighborhoods and city centers, while bus tours can cover more ground in less time.
For travelers interested in deeper cultural knowledge, expert-led tours can provide valuable information about local history, architecture, traditions, and important landmarks. Food tours can introduce visitors to regional cuisine, while adventure tours may include hiking, water activities, or other outdoor experiences.
Think about the pace and format you prefer before booking. A highly structured tour may be perfect for first-time visitors, while independent travelers may prefer shorter activities that leave more room for exploration.

Consider Timing and Location
Timing can affect both the quality and cost of your experiences. Early morning visits may be quieter at popular attractions, while evening activities can offer a completely different atmosphere. Check opening hours and estimated visit durations before planning your day.
Location is equally important. If you book a morning tour on one side of the city and an afternoon attraction several miles away, transportation can consume valuable vacation time. Planning activities geographically can make your itinerary more efficient and less stressful.
Check Reviews and Booking Policies
Before committing to a tour or activity, read recent customer reviews and carefully examine the booking details. Reviews can reveal useful information about guides, organization, crowd levels, accessibility, and the overall quality of an experience.
Also check cancellation policies, meeting points, duration, inclusions, and any requirements that participants need to know beforehand. A few minutes of research can prevent unexpected problems during your trip.
Keep Your Travel Budget Balanced
A memorable weekend does not require booking an expensive activity every day. Mix premium experiences with affordable or free activities. Many destinations offer beautiful parks, public spaces, walking routes, markets, and cultural areas that can be explored without spending much money.
Set aside a specific portion of your travel budget for tours and experiences. This gives you the freedom to book activities you genuinely value without compromising other parts of your trip, such as accommodation, transportation, or dining.
